Periodical PROPOSITUM

A periodical of Franciscan history and spirituality of the Third Order Regular published by the International Franciscan Conference.

The pubblication takes its name and inspiration from “Franciscanum Vitae Propositum”, the Apostolic Brief of 8 December 1982, by which Pope John Paul II approved and promulgated the revised Rule and Life of the Brothers and Sisters of the Third Order Regular of St. Francis.
